Article Summary:
Thailand’s tourism industry is experiencing significant growth in 2026, driven by a surge in solo travelers. This trend is benefiting Thai Airways and local hotels, which are capitalizing on the increased demand for independent travel experiences. The article highlights the convenience and premium services offered by Thai Airways, as well as the appeal of Thailand’s rich culture, pristine beaches, and world-class hospitality to solo adventurers. This shift in travel preferences is reshaping the tourism landscape, emphasizing the importance of flexibility and self-discovery in travel planning.
